Scrunchy Boots F/W 08.09

Im talking about boots that almost seem slim at the knee then when they get to the enkle they scrunch and become wider almost...

they were biggest at rick owens and balenciaga but it seems as thoguh several other designers are adopting the look...

start with balenciaga pree fall 08
